Subject: Quickstore 4.2 — bloom filter now fronts the KV layer

Plugin authors: starting with this release, Quickstore places a bloom filter ahead of the key-value store. Negative lookups return faster; false positives fall through safely. No API changes are required on your side. Verify your plugin against the staging build referenced below.

session token of fahif-tadup = htk3_9c7

Subject: Inkwell markdown pipeline 5.1 deployed

On-call: the Inkwell rendering pipeline is now on 5.1 in production. Changes: sanitizer runs before the table parser, footnote rendering is cached per document, and the fallback plain-text path no longer strips headings. If render latency alarms fire, roll back via the standard script — it handles cache invalidation. Known issue: nested blockquotes over six levels render flat. The deployment trace token follows.

build token for hawep-kageg: htk14_558814e2114cc7

**Ticket: TAXCACHE misconfig on staging**

Staging box for Rateseeker's tax-rate lookup cache is returning stale Pellford County rates. Root cause: `.env` was copied from the old Quillmont deployment and still points at the retired upstream feed. Fix: update `RATESEEKER_FEED_URL` to the current endpoint, flush the cache with `rateseeker flush --all`, and restart the worker. New folks: the cache will refuse to warm without a valid signing key. Open the `.env`, scroll to the bottom, and append the signing key line as follows:

env line for kaguf-hahop: COURIER_KEY29=2e2fa9479f98362396e2c28f86fc9

Ticket: Landlord site audit — Thurleigh Point, next Thursday morning.

Heads-up for whoever's on the desk: two auditors from the landlord's agent will be walking the building, roughly 9:00 to noon. They'll want riser cupboards, plant room, and the roof access log. Please tidy the loading bay beforehand and have last quarter's inspection folder ready. They'll need escorting through the plant room; the door code is below.

door code, yagap-bahof: bdg-O-05